Spraying Systems Co AutoJet food safety systems

Meat and poultry processors all have a common goal, and that is to ensure the highest level of food safety possible in their operations. Spraying Systems Co has developed a range of AutoJet food safety systems that minimise the possibility of contamination while also often extending the shelf life of the products.

The AutoJet food safety systems ensure exact application and uniform coverage of antimicrobials and sanitisers to enhance product safety with minimal waste. The systems consist of an AutoJet spray controller and PulsaJet automatic spray nozzles fitted with UniJet spray tips in food-grade materials. They are suitable for spraying antimicrobial agents on bagged whole muscle products, formed products, fresh meats, packaged poultry and sliced meat products and can be used for effective and repeatable sanitising of conveyors and surrounding equipment.

Benefits of the systems include their ability to allow for numerous volumes of antimicrobial and sanitising agents to be used on a single conveyor line and the systems can be easily incorporated into existing product lines.

According to the company, the systems have been proven to effectively control the prevalence of pathogens and they are able to be incorporated into existing HACCP plans.
